Gus joined Mules N More in August 2025 after spending the last 15 years as a pasture companion. Now, he’s discovering the world with fresh eyes — and he’s proving himself to be incredibly smart, curious, and eager to learn.
Gus is still building confidence, making him an exciting blank-slate project for someone experienced. He’s sharp, willing, and picks up new things quickly — he just needs the right person to guide him.
He stands on cross ties, loads on a trailer, is barefoot, and is great for both the vet and farrier. Gus is up to date on him rabies, 6-way, dental, deworming, and has a negative Coggins.
Gus is insulin resistant and will require a home without lush pasture. He is very well managed and we have recent x-rays and bloodwork upon request.

We rescue pigs, mules, horses, and other farm animals, offering them the medical care, shelter, and rehabilitation they require to thrive. Our primary mission is to find permanent, responsible homes for these animals, ensuring they are placed in environments where they can live happy and healthy lives.
In addition to rescuing and adopting out animals, we are committed to providing adopters with the education and resources they need to care for their new companions. We offer guidance on proper care, health management, and safe handling, ensuring that adopters are fully prepared to meet the needs of their adopted animals. Our adoption process includes thorough screening to ensure a good match between the animal and the adopter, and we provide continued support to ensure the animals’ well-being long after adoption.
We believe that education is key to preventing future abandonment and ensuring the longevity of the animal-human bond. By equipping adopters with knowledge and resources, we help ensure that our animals are not only rescued but also given a second chance at a fulfilling life in a supportive, well-informed home.
